Confinement Control in Solid-State Photochemistry

10.1021/ja00188a092

The research encompasses three distinct studies. The first investigates electrostatic complexing and covalent bonding in enzyme electrodes, focusing on glucose oxidase and a polycationic redox polymer. It demonstrates that while electrostatic complexes can facilitate electron transfer, covalent bonding significantly enhances stability and efficiency, even at high ionic strengths. The second study explores solid-state photochemistry, examining how crystalline environments can control photochemical reactions, leading to different products compared to those in solution. Key chemicals include tetraphenyldicyanotriene, 4,5,5-triphenyl-2-cyclohexenone, and 1,1,3,3-tetraphenyl-1,4-pentadiene. The third study reports the electrochemical fixation of carbon dioxide in oxoglutaric acid using isocitrate dehydrogenase (ICDH) as an electrocatalyst and methylviologen (MV2?) as a mediator, achieving high current efficiencies and mild reaction conditions. The conclusion highlights the potential of enzymes as electrocatalysts for organic compound fixation without the need for NADP?.
